Nickname
01

soprannome, nomignolo

a familiar or humorous name given to someone that is connected with their real name, appearance, or with something they have done
example
Esempi
After winning the pie-eating contest, he was nicknamed " Pie King. "
Dopo aver vinto la gara di mangiare torte, gli è stato dato il soprannome di «Re delle Torte».
